Output 3931ea59f27d07ed08bfc7ba5f41bc8ee8c68cd78ba6962f1e7ab69f17b1a750:0

value
512761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d637f39192a81cadd7f47a66bc32728483842ce1 OP_EQUAL
address
3MDhZAo2FBhyUSkXLYu9JoxXntaUcb6pUQ
transaction
3931ea59f27d07ed08bfc7ba5f41bc8ee8c68cd78ba6962f1e7ab69f17b1a750
spent
true